Guodian Nanjing Automation PSM 692U Motor Comprehensive Protection and Control Device


1 Functions
1) Current quick-break protection
2) Definite-time overcurrent protection
3) Two-stage definite-time negative sequence overcurrent protection / inverse-time negative sequence protection
4) Overheat protection
5) Locked-rotor protection
6) Single-phase grounding protection
7) Undervoltage protection
8) Overload protection
9) Non-electrical protection
10) F-C blocking function
11) 4-20mA output
12) 9 fault recordings, 2 startup recordings
13) I, U, P, Q, Cosφ, active energy, reactive energy, 14-channel switch status acquisition
14) GPS time synchronization (minute pulse, second pulse, or IRIG-B mode)

2 Principle Description
2.1 Current Quick-Break Protection
During the startup process of an asynchronous motor, the current is very high, typically reaching 5 to 8 times the rated current (Ie), and the startup time can last up to several tens of seconds. The device is equipped with two quick-break settings. During the startup process, the "startup quick-break setting" is used, which is set to avoid the motor starting current. After the motor startup process is completed, the "post-startup quick-break setting" is automatically adopted. This value is determined based on the motor's self-starting current and the larger feedback current during an external outlet short circuit, taking the larger of the two currents.
a) The startup time tst is set to avoid the longer startup time, tst > tstx.
b) The setting value during startup Iop.h is set to avoid the motor starting current Ist, i.e.:
When t ≤ tst, Iop.h = krel × Ist. To avoid the influence of non-periodic components, krel is taken as 1.5, and Ist is (6~8)Ie.
c) The setting value during operation Iop.l is set to avoid the self-starting current and the larger feedback short-circuit current during an external outlet short circuit. The magnitude of the self-starting current is related to factors such as the delay of backup power automatic switching. When the plant power fast switching is successful, the motor almost does not undergo a self-starting process because the speed has not significantly decreased. Only during residual voltage switching or synchronous capture switching, when the motor speed has significantly decreased, the self-starting current can be large. According to traditional calculation methods, the self-starting current Iast = 5Ie, Iop.l = krel × Iast × Ie = 1.3 × 5 × Ie = 6.5Ie.
For an external outlet three-phase short circuit, considering the inherent delay of the protection (40~60)ms, the feedback current Ifb = 6Ie.
Iop.l = krel × Ifb = 1.3 × 6Ie = 7.8Ie.
d) The short delay of the quick-break protection is used to coordinate with the F-C circuit.
